Description
Original Campanian cheese with a mixed pulled-curd (pasta filata) from buffalo and cow milk, produced by a cheesemaker–farmer from Campania. The combination of the two milks creates an uneven, milky paste with distinct buttery notes that make it recognizable and very versatile. Appearance: Pale straw-colored paste, uneven due to the different pastes contained. Rind pale straw-yellow. Taste: Lactic, persistent, with buttery notes and slight buffalo notes. Pairings: White wines or pale beers, red tomato jam, rye bread, artisanal breadsticks. Technical sheet: Milk: Pasteurized buffalo and cow milk | Processing: Artisanal | Paste: Pulled-curd (pasta filata) | Salting: Dry-salted | Aging: Minimum 10 days | Fat: 27% fat on dry matter (m.g.s.s.) | Region: Campania Ideal for: Specialty customers interested in Campania, alternatives to mozzarella, thematic Campanian cheese boards.
